全球农场管理软体市场预计到2030年将达到101亿美元
全球农场管理软体市场规模在2024年估计为45亿美元,预计到2030年将达到101亿美元,在分析期间(2024-2030年)内复合年增长率(CAGR)为14.3%。本报告分析的细分市场之一-基于Web的部署,预计将以13.3%的复合年增长率成长,并在分析期间结束时达到58亿美元。云端部署细分市场预计在分析期间将以15.6%的复合年增长率成长。
美国市场规模估计为13亿美元,而中国市场预计将以13.5%的复合年增长率成长。
据估计,2024年美国农场管理软体市场规模将达13亿美元。作为世界第二大经济体,中国预计到2030年市场规模将达到15亿美元,2024年至2030年的复合年增长率(CAGR)为13.5%。其他值得关注的区域市场分析包括日本和加拿大,预计在分析期内,这两个国家的复合年增长率将分别达到12.4%和12.0%。在欧洲,德国预计将以约10.3%的复合年增长率成长。

农场管理软体如何改变农业并提高效率?
农场管理软体正在改变农业产业,它能够帮助农民简化营运、优化资源配置并做出数据驱动的决策。这类软体旨在帮助管理农业生产的各个方面,包括作物管理、牲畜监测、财务追踪和设备维护。随着现代农业日益复杂,农场管理软体能够实现精准控制和规划,从而提高生产力和永续性。透过整合来自感测器、无人机、GPS系统和天气预报的数据,这些平台为农民提供即时讯息,帮助他们管理从灌溉计划到土壤健康和病虫害防治等方方面面。
农场管理软体正在革新农业,它为农民提供各种工具,帮助他们最大限度地提高产量,同时降低成本并减少对环境的影响。随着全球粮食需求的成长和气候变迁问题的日益严峻,农场管理软体能够有效利用水、肥料和劳动力等资源,这一点至关重要。透过自动化记录保存、合规报告和库存管理等任务,农场管理软体还能减轻农民的行政负担,使他们能够将更多时间投入田间作业。随着科技的不断进步,农场管理软体正成为农民优化流程、实施精密农业并应对现代农业挑战的必备工具。
为什么农场管理软体对于优化农场营运效率和永续性至关重要?
农场管理软体对于优化农业营运和促进永续性至关重要,因为它使农民能够利用即时数据和高级分析做出明智的决策,从而提高效率并减少废弃物。例如,在作物种植中,这些系统有助于监测土壤湿度、植物健康状况和病虫害活动等变量,使农民能够仅在需要的地方施用适量的水、肥料和农药。这不仅可以最大限度地提高产量,还可以最大限度地减少可能降低土壤品质和污染水源的投入过度使用。透过更好的资源管理,农场管理软体在精密农业技术的推广应用方面发挥关键作用,这些技术在提高生产力的同时保护了环境。
此外,农场管理软体透过流程自动化和改进任务管理来提高营运效率。例如,它可以实现设备维护计划和进度管理、劳动生产力监控以及财务资料管理,包括支出、收入和盈利。畜牧养殖户也可以从农场管理软体中受益,透过监控动物健康状况、饲料摄取量和生长速度,更好地进行畜群管理和优化生产週期。将农场营运整合到一个平台上可以减少低效环节,降低营运成本,并确保符合监管标准。这对于必须管理复杂营运并遵守多项政府法规的大型农场和农业相关企业尤其重要。
在农业领域中,农场管理软体有哪些日益增长的应用与创新?
农业管理软体的应用和创新正在迅速扩展,新的工具和技术正在改善农业的各个方面,从播种和收割到财务规划和市场分析。在作物种植领域,精密农业是农业管理软体最重要的应用之一。整合感测器和GPS技术的精密农业工具使农民能够以前所未有的精度监测土壤状况、预测天气模式并分析作物健康。这些系统帮助农民更有效率地施用水、种子和肥料等投入品,从而提高产量并减少废弃物。无人机等创新技术的整合进一步增强了精密农业,使农民能够从空中勘测田地,发现问题区域并即时评估作物健康状况。
在畜牧管理中,农场管理软体用于监测动物健康状况、追踪饲料转换率和管理繁殖週期。物联网 (IoT) 感测器使农民能够监测动物的生命体征,例如心率、体温和活动水平,从而及早发现健康问题并改善整个畜群的管理。这些系统还有助于优化饲料配方和监测生长速度,确保动物有效率且永续达到上市体重。另一个创新领域是利用机器学习演算法分析历史农场数据并进行预测分析。这使农民能够根据天气、作物状况和市场趋势预测产量、管理风险并规划未来的种植计划。
农场经营管理软体在财务和营运管理中也发挥着至关重要的作用,它提供预算编制、预测和盈利分析等工具。农民可以利用这些平台追踪支出、收入和利润率,从而就作物轮作计画、人事费用和资本投资做出明智的决策。这些系统也能提供政府法规合规报告,确保农民符合环境、劳工和安全标准,避免受到处罚。此外,将区块链技术整合到农场管理软体中,可以提高供应链的透明度,让消费者能够追溯食品从农场到餐桌的来源。这不仅提高了食品安全,还有助于建立消费者对永续和符合伦理的农业实践的信任。
人工智慧 (AI) 与巨量资料的融合正推动农场管理软体的进一步创新。 AI 平台能够分析大量的农场数据,产生可执行的洞察,例如优化播种计划、预测病虫害爆发以及确定最佳灌溉时间。这些洞察使农民能够快速应对不断变化的环境,并最大限度地提高产量。随着科技的进步,农场管理软体日趋完善,使农民能够更精准、更有效率地管理农场营运。凭藉这些创新,农场管理软体有望彻底改变农场的运作方式,提高生产力、永续性和韧性。

Global Farm Management Software Market to Reach US$10.1 Billion by 2030
The global market for Farm Management Software estimated at US$4.5 Billion in the year 2024, is expected to reach US$10.1 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 14.3%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Web-based Deployment, one of the segments analyzed in the report, is expected to record a 13.3% CAGR and reach US$5.8 Billion by the end of the analysis period. Growth in the Cloud Deployment segment is estimated at 15.6% CAGR over the analysis period.
The U.S. Market is Estimated at US$1.3 Billion While China is Forecast to Grow at 13.5% CAGR
The Farm Management Software market in the U.S. is estimated at US$1.3 Billion in the year 2024. China, the world's second largest economy, is forecast to reach a projected market size of US$1.5 Billion by the year 2030 trailing a CAGR of 13.5%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Among the other noteworthy geographic markets are Japan and Canada, each forecast to grow at a CAGR of 12.4% and 12.0% respectively over the analysis period. Within Europe, Germany is forecast to grow at approximately 10.3% CAGR.
Global Farm Management Software Market - Key Trends and Drivers Summarized
How Is Farm Management Software Revolutionizing Agriculture and Increasing Efficiency?
Farm management software is transforming the agricultural industry by enabling farmers to streamline operations, optimize resources, and make data-driven decisions. This software is designed to help manage various aspects of farming, including crop management, livestock monitoring, financial tracking, and equipment maintenance. With the increasing complexity of modern farming, farm management software allows for precise control and planning, improving both productivity and sustainability. By integrating data from sensors, drones, GPS systems, and weather forecasts, these platforms offer farmers real-time insights that help them manage everything from irrigation schedules to soil health and pest control.
The use of farm management software is revolutionizing agriculture by providing tools that help farmers maximize yields while reducing costs and minimizing environmental impact. It allows for more efficient use of resources such as water, fertilizers, and labor, which is critical as the world faces growing food demand and climate challenges. By automating tasks like record-keeping, compliance reporting, and inventory management, farm management software also reduces administrative burdens, giving farmers more time to focus on field operations. As technology continues to advance, farm management software is becoming an essential tool for farmers looking to optimize their processes, embrace precision agriculture, and meet the challenges of modern farming.
Why Is Farm Management Software Critical for Optimizing Operations and Sustainability in Agriculture?
Farm management software is critical for optimizing operations and promoting sustainability in agriculture because it allows farmers to leverage real-time data and advanced analytics to make informed decisions that boost efficiency and reduce waste. In crop farming, for example, these systems help monitor variables such as soil moisture, crop health, and pest activity, enabling farmers to apply the right amount of water, fertilizers, and pesticides only where needed. This not only maximizes crop yield but also minimizes the overuse of inputs, which can deplete soil quality and contaminate water sources. Through better resource management, farm management software plays a crucial role in implementing precision agriculture techniques that improve productivity while preserving the environment.
Additionally, farm management software enhances operational efficiency by automating processes and improving task management. For example, it can schedule and track equipment maintenance, monitor labor productivity, and manage financial data such as expenses, revenue, and profitability. Livestock farmers can also benefit from farm management software, using it to monitor the health, feed intake, and growth rates of their animals, ensuring better herd management and optimizing production cycles. By consolidating farm operations into a single platform, farmers can reduce inefficiencies, cut down on operational costs, and ensure compliance with regulatory standards. This is especially important for larger farms and agribusinesses that must manage complex operations and comply with multiple government regulations.
What Are the Expanding Applications and Innovations in Farm Management Software Across Agriculture?
The applications and innovations in farm management software are rapidly expanding, with new tools and technologies enhancing every aspect of farming, from planting and harvesting to financial planning and market analysis. In crop farming, precision agriculture is one of the most significant applications of farm management software. Precision agriculture tools, integrated with sensors and GPS technology, allow farmers to monitor soil conditions, predict weather patterns, and analyze crop health with unprecedented accuracy. These systems help farmers apply inputs like water, seeds, and fertilizers more efficiently, thereby increasing yield and reducing waste. Innovations such as drone integration are further enhancing precision agriculture, enabling farmers to perform aerial surveys of their fields to detect problem areas or assess crop conditions in real-time.
In livestock management, farm management software is used to monitor animal health, track feed efficiency, and manage breeding cycles. With IoT (Internet of Things) sensors, farmers can monitor vital signs such as heart rate, temperature, and activity levels in their animals, allowing for early detection of health issues and better overall herd management. These systems also help farmers optimize feed rations and monitor growth rates, ensuring that animals reach market weight efficiently and sustainably. Another area of innovation is the use of machine learning algorithms to analyze historical farm data and provide predictive analytics, helping farmers forecast yields, manage risks, and plan for future seasons based on trends in weather, crop performance, and market conditions.
Farm management software is also playing a key role in financial and operational management, offering tools for budgeting, forecasting, and profitability analysis. Farmers can use these platforms to track expenses, revenue, and margins, helping them make informed decisions about crop rotations, labor costs, and equipment investments. These systems also provide reports for compliance with government regulations, ensuring that farms meet environmental, labor, and safety standards without incurring penalties. Moreover, the integration of blockchain technology into farm management software is enabling greater transparency in the supply chain, allowing consumers to trace the origin of their food products from farm to table. This not only enhances food safety but also builds consumer trust in sustainable and ethical farming practices.
The integ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and big data is driving further innovation in farm management software. AI-powered platforms can analyze vast amounts of farm data to generate actionable insights, such as optimizing planting schedules, predicting pest outbreaks, or determining the best times to irrigate. These insights allow farmers to adapt more quickly to changing conditions and maximize their outputs. As technology continues to advance, farm management software is becoming more sophisticated, offering farmers the ability to manage their operations with greater precision and efficiency. With these innovations, farm management software is poised to revolutionize the way farms operate, making them more productive, sustainable, and resilient.
